Preparation of an Allylamine Hydrochloride-Based Hydrogel: a Nonabsorbed Calcium-and AluminumFree Phosphate Binder

By : Haisong Zhang, Hua Yuan, Meng Yu, Hailei Zhang, Libin Bai

Page No: 245-257

Abstract
In this study, a cross-linked allylamine hydrochloride (ALH)-based hydrogel was synthesized as a potential non-absorbed chelator for phosphorus ions. The hydrogel was well-characterized by infrared spectroscopy, powder X-Ray diffraction and Scanning Electron Microscope. The binding capacities of ALH-based hydrogel were compared to commercial available preparations. The results demonstrate that ALH-based hydrogel is capable of removing phosphorus ions from dialysate effluent of which the composition is very similar to human body fluid. The ALH-based hydrogel exhibits a much better binding effect than that of medicinal charcoal tablets. The destructive tests give the result that the ALH-based hydrogel possesses a good stability in acid environment and oxidation environment, suggesting a good stability in gastrointestinal tract after oral administration. Thus, the obtained hydrogel may have potential applications in environmental management, wastewater treatment as well as treatment of hyperphosphatemia patients.
